Stamps are what you think they are. They are postage. Currently I believe they are at 59 cents/stamp to mail. Some people don't mind trading coupons for stamps. I believe if you are new, and want to join a trade..some traders request you include stamps
Do you mean when people talk about trading stamps? That just means that instead of sending coupons, you send a postage stamp. That way you're not "paying" for the coupons, but it's something everyone wants / uses.
Exactly, I often trade for postage stamps with locals so I can do more trading through the mail. Works really well for newbies who have nothing to trade but want to get started. Of course, never trade someone value for value. Example: I have a $1.50 off coupon you want and I would never ask for 2 stamps in exchange. Usually when I have an extra redplum, P&G or smart source insert I only ask for ONE stamp for the entire insert (unless it needs to be mailed then I will ask for an extra one to cover postage) but for those in Edmonton who pick up the inserts then just one stamp and so on.

The going rate is 1 p stamp (permanent unused stamp) = .59 cents Canadian Tire Money = $5 worth of coupons.
I trade for stamps and CT money all the time. That way I still am able to get my coupons to someone who would use them and I can use the stamps/CT money for future trades. But, you want to trade for more than $5 at a time. For example, if you request $5 worth of coupons and send me 1 stamp it costs me 1 stamp to send them and then I've broken even on the stamp and lost $5 worth of coupons, so minimum $10 trade or you send an extra stamp for postage if under the $5 mark. Most experienced traders are really generous and send lots of extra coupons they think you could use or are on your wish list. That's why it's super important to have you "About" page visible on your profile they can see you wish list when you add one.
Here are the current larger trading rates among SC:
$50 'start up coupons' not handpicked by trader = 5 stamps/$3.95 CT money
$100 'start up coupons' not handpicked by trader = 10 stamps/5$GC/$6.65 CT money
$20 hand picked coupons = 4 stamps/$2.30 CT money
$50 hand picked coupons = 10 stamps/$5 GC/$6.65 CT money
$100 hand picked coupons = 15 stamps/$10 GC minimum/$13.95 CT money
It's also appreciated that people who want 100$ in coupons would include extra stamps for postage.
